Manual Data Entry
Developers should learn about Manual Data Entry to understand data processing workflows, especially when building or maintaining systems that rely on human input, such as CRUD applications, administrative dashboards, or data migration tools
Pros
- +It is essential for scenarios where automation is impractical due to unstructured data, low volume, or the need for human validation, such as in data cleaning, legacy system updates, or small-scale operations
